Tanner Banks was sent down Thursday. (Madeline Ressler/Phillies Nation) PHILADELPHIA — Tanner Banks wore street clothes — a T-shirt and a black hat — as he went around the home clubhouse at Citizens Bank Park on Thursday afternoon, dapped up teammates and said goodbye for now.
